The Wounded Warrior Project (WWP) Analytics & Insights Senior Specialist-Programs Marketing serves as subject matter expert within the Marketing Analytics & Insights team to inform, persuade, influence, and support warrior-driven initiatives and to leverage Marketing and Programs platform data to gain a deep understanding of WWP Programs metrics, uncover trends, and drive strategy behind key organization-wide growth initiatives across new and existing programs.


 

D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Serve as the key liaison between Marketing and WWP’s Metrics/Impact Evaluation team to collect and analyze data and assist in storytelling and reporting.
  • Lead the efforts to define, collect, analyze, and interpret complex data on warriors needs, programs, and market changes.
  • Consolidate data and information into actionable items, reports, and presentations. Synthesize findings and prepare reports, presentations, and white papers that communicate the story. Illustrate data graphically and translate complex findings into written text and presentations.
  • Investigate and evaluate marketing methods, insights, and various marketing channels to develop an innovative approach to strategies using qualitative and quantitative research.
  • Utilize an in-depth knowledge of WWP programs and market research to create and distribute reporting that influence strategic decision-making among program teams.
  • Work closely with Metrics/Impact Evaluation, Program Operations, and teammates to synthesize analyses and key insights into clear, concise recommendations for operational decision-making in support of organizational priorities related to impact and outcome measurement.
  • Collaborate with business partners on decision-making to execute on strategies and evaluate performance to measure results.
  • Influence decisions while developing strategy and roadmaps for Program Marketing to drive engagement in WWP programs.
  • Deliver recommendations to connect overall organizational growth and business objectives within Marketing and Metrics strategies and programs.
  • Identify and drive improvements to data-related processes, tools, and systems.
  • Evaluate program methodology and key data to ensure Marketing and Metrics/Impact Evaluation are aligned for full funnel data analysis.
  • Contribute to the overall success of the program marketing by staying on top of marketing channel best practices, trends, innovative ideas, strategies, and industry standards.
  • Respond to and perform ad hoc assignments, as necessary.
  • Other duties as assigned.
